1. The Psychological Impact of Athlete Injuries
Emotional Struggles Beyond the Physical
Injuries often plunge athletes into emotional turmoil—feelings of frustration, isolation, and self-doubt. Naomi Osaka, for example, has candidly shared her mental health battles exacerbated by physical strain. Such setbacks challenge identity and spirit, but also open doors to new narratives of personal growth.

2. The Power of Resilience: Giannis Antetokounmpo’s Journey
From Injury to MVP: A Testament of Grit
Giannis Antetokounmpo’s career trajectory is emblematic of resilience. Facing injuries early on, he used them as catalysts to improve and redefine his game. His perseverance through physical pain and doubt offers an inspiring case study for overcoming setbacks in any endeavor.
